In class-based object-oriented programming, a constructor (abbreviation: ctor) is a special type of subroutine called to create an object . It prepares the new object for use, often accepting arguments that the constructor uses to set required member variables.

There can be multiple constructors in a class . However, the parameter list of the constructors should not be same. This is known as constructor overloading.

The constructor is used to allocate the memory if required and constructing the object of class whereas, a destructor is used to perform required clean-up when an object is destroyed . The destructor is called automatically by the compiler when an object gets destroyed.
